SDA can refer to several different technologies, making it ambiguous without further context. Here are a few possibilities: * **Software-Defined Access (SDA):** This is a networking architecture that uses software to automate network provisioning, management, and segmentation. It simplifies network operations and enhances security. Cisco DNA Center is a common platform for SDA. * **Serial Data Analysis (SDA):** Used in embedded systems and hardware debugging. It allows engineers to capture and analyze serial data streams for troubleshooting and performance optimization. * **Statistical Data Analysis (SDA):** It refers to the application of statistical methods and techniques to analyze data. This is a broad field used in many disciplines.
